There is a gate leading to the enclosed garden with paved patio area and lawn with pergola and raised ornamental fish pond with two stores.Botesdale:The recently bypassed and adjoining villages of Rickinghall and Botesdale lie about 14 miles to the north east of Bury St. Edmunds. The market town of Diss is about 7 miles away where there are good everyday amenities and an Inter City railway service to London's Liverpool Street. Local village facilities include shops, Co-Op, Takeaways, Post Office, Primary School, Health Centre, Garage and Public Houses.Local Authority & Council Tax Band:Mid Suffolk District Council.
